One day after MdVarsity.com broke the story that Dan Harwood, the enormously successful and well respected longtime Head Coach at Magruder High School will be taking over as the Head Coach at Good Counsel beginning with the 2005-2006 season, we went out to get reactions from some of the top local coaches who have coached against Dan Harwood and/or have a perspective on how quickly Harwood might build Good Counsel into a WCAC power:
GLENN FARELLO (Eleanor Roosevelt HS/Coached against Dan Harwood and Magruder HS in the Maryland 4A Championship Game in 2001):

"Dan is a phenomenal coach and a great guy. He is very personable and very well liked and respected by his peers. We'll miss him in Maryland public school coaching. I have no doubt that he'll be very successful at Good Counsel. One of the things that I liked about Dan was that he not only won, his teams were always fun to watch- the way they moved the ball and shot the three-pointer. But he also gets his teams to play great defense and scrap and play hard. His teams were not always the most athletic, but they always play hard and play smart. It is interesting, with the Olympics going on now, you can see some similiarities between the Magruder teams and the best international teams in terms of how they play."

KEITH ADAMS (Head Coach at Springbrook HS/has had a great Montgomery County 4A rivalry with Coach Harwood and Magruder):
"Dan leaving Magruder is a great loss for Montgomery County. Obviously, we are going to miss him at Magruder. I think Magruder will still be a good program, but I know we'll miss Dan's competitiveness. as a coach, you loved the challenge of going against him. For guys like Damon (Damon Pigrom of Blake HS) and myself, it was a great challenge coaching against a competitor like Harwood. I understand Dan's reasons for leaving, he'll get more time with the kids, more year-round access to his players. Hey, all of us coaches are competitors, the chance to coach in the WCAC is a great challenge, I don't blame Dan for going after that...he'll do a great job at Good Counsel. Dan could wind-up cornering the market on talent in Montgomery County. No one is going to out coach him, it will just be question of how soon he can get the players. The way that Dan is leaving Magruder works out for everyone, the seven months gives Magruder a chance to transition to a new coach. I still think Magruder will be good after he's gone. I got to say, as a fan, i think it will be fascinating watching Dan go to the WCAC. It is one of the best leagues in the country and he just made it better. I'm sorry to see Dan leaving the county, but I understand his reasons. he's a great guy and a great coach, I'm happy for him."

DAMON PIGROM (Head Coach at Blake HS/Montgomery County 4A Rival):
"I'm happy for Coach Harwood. I understand his thinking behind the move. Speaking for myself, someday I'd like to be in a position to coach in a situation where you can work with the kids all year round, spend more time working with your players. That is a big advantage for the private schools right now. I admit that I kind of envy the private school coaches in that regard. On the one hand, I'm happy for him, on the other hand, I'll miss coaching against him. Just like my players get psyched-up for playing Magruder, I got excited about competing against Dan. The Magruder games were always 'big time' games."
